Yinrih longevity and its effects on human-yinrih cultural integration

You know that old joke about soviet citizens waiting 10 years for a new car? I bet a yinrih would hear that and shrug. “10 years? That doesn't sound so– Oh wait, that's like over a tenth of your total lifespan.”

This is why I sometimes think the two species wouldn't integrate well on a societal level. Humans would change too fast for yinrih, and yinrih wouldn't do anything fast enough for humans. Hearthside would ironically be the worst at this.

One of the reasons terraforming is economically viable for them is the original investors in a given terraforming project will live to see the fruits of their efforts.
